WebReverse transcription-polymerase chain reaction (RT-PCR) is a sensitive in vitro method and has a crucial role in medical science and biomaterial fields. RT-PCR is used for detecting and comparing the levels of mRNA and the surface proteins ( Leong et al., 2007; Wang and Brown, 1999 ). PCR can be performed in real-time PCR and end-point PCR. In a whole … WebTruenat is a chip-based, point-of-care, rapid molecular test for diagnosis of infectious diseases. The technology is based on the Taqman RTPCR (Real Time Reverse Transcription Polymerase Chain Reaction) chemistry which can be performed on the portable, battery operated Truelab Real Time micro PCR platform. Webrt-pcr. RT- PCR: a highly sensitive technique for the detection and quantitation of mRNA ( messenger RNA ). The technique consists of two parts: The synthesis of cDNA (complementary DNA) from RNA by reverse transcription ( RT) and. The amplification of a specific cDNA by the polymerase chain reaction (PCR).
